make-bootstrap-tools: fix #13629: glibc problems
On x86_64-linux glibc started to use linker scripts more extensively.

diff --git a/pkgs/stdenv/linux/make-bootstrap-tools.nix b/pkgs/stdenv/linux/make-bootstrap-tools.nix index ef651f643684..3c8948699726 100644 --- a/pkgs/stdenv/linux/make-bootstrap-tools.nix +++ b/pkgs/stdenv/linux/make-bootstrap-tools.nix @@ -51,7 +51,15 @@ rec { cp -d ${glibc}/lib/crt?.o $out/lib cp -rL ${glibc}/include $out - chmod -R u+w $out/include + chmod -R u+w "$out" + + # glibc can contain linker scripts: find them, copy their deps, + # and get rid of absolute paths (nuke-refs would make them useless) + local lScripts=$(grep --files-with-matches --max-count=1 'GNU ld script' -R "$out/lib") + cp -d -t "$out/lib/" $(cat $lScripts | tr " " "\n" | grep -F '${glibc}' | sort -u) + for f in $lScripts; do + substituteInPlace "$f" --replace '${glibc}/lib/' "" + done # Hopefully we won't need these. rm -rf $out/include/mtd $out/include/rdma $out/include/sound $out/include/video |
